This issue of McDermott Will & Schulte’s Healthcare Regulatory Check-Up highlights regulatory activity for July 2025, including the results of the US Department of Justice’s (DOJ) 2025 National Health Care Fraud Takedown, DOJ and the US Department of Health and Human Services’ (HHS) new False Claims Act (FCA) Working Group, and three Office of Inspector General (OIG) advisory opinions. We discuss a pharmaceutical company’s challenge to the FCA qui tam provisions.
